Interwood HOP 25/1300: 500-Tonne Multi-Daylight Hydraulic Veneer Press

High-Volume Precision Pressing for Industrial Door and Panel Production

The Heavy-Duty Standard for Commercial Veneering

The Interwood HOP 25/1300 is engineered for high-output environments requiring consistent, high-tonnage pressure across multiple workpieces simultaneously.  This upstroke, multi-daylight machine is the industry benchmark for laminating and veneering MDF, chipboard, security doors, and flush doors.  Utilising an oil-heated hydraulic system and 8 heavy-duty cylinders, the HOP 25/1300 ensures uniform heat distribution and pressure, critical for the curing of high-performance adhesives in batch production.

Industrial Applications & Capacity

Designed for the rigours of 24/7 production lines, this 18,500kg machine provides the stability required for:

  • High-Volume Door Manufacturing: 5-daylight openings allow for the simultaneous pressing of multiple flush or security doors.
  • Specialised Panel Work: Perfect for laminate panels, furniture fronts, and composite insulation materials.
  • Bespoke Fitting Production: Adjustable closing speeds and temperature control up to 120 Celsius allow for delicate veneer work on high-end interior fittings. 

Technical Specifications

  • Worktable Dimension 2500 x 1300mm
  • Platen Thickness 40mm Solid Steel
  • Working Pressure 500T (14Kg/CM2)
  • Max Opening 100mm x 5
  • Main Cylinders 8 of 200mm.
  • Heating Method Oil
  • Heating Power 84kw
  • Closing Speed 20-60mm/sec
  • Max Temperature 120.C
  • Installed power 7.5kw
  • Overall dimensions 4150 x 1800 x 2550mm
  • Weight 18500kg

Site Preparation & Installation Checklist

For Interwood HOP 25/1300 Multi-Daylight Veneer Press

Because of the high-tonnage pressure and significant weight of the HOP 25/1300, specific site conditions must be met prior to delivery and installation.  We do go through this with you at the time of purchase.  If you wish you can use this checklist as a guide to ensure your facility is prepared.

1.  Structural & Floor Loading

The total weight of this machine is 18,500 kg.  This requires a reinforced concrete foundation to prevent settling or cracking under static and dynamic loads.

  • Minimum Floor Specification: A minimum of 200mm-250mm reinforced concrete slab is typically required.
  • Leveling: The floor must be level within 2mm over the entire 4150mm x 1800mm footprint to ensure even platen pressure and oil circulation.
  • Vibration Dampening: While the machine is a static press, specialised mounting pads are recommended to protect the floor and ensure longevity.

2.  Electrical & Power Supply

The HOP25/1300 is a high-demand thermal and hydraulic system.

  • Heating Load: The oil-heating system requires 84kw.
  • Motor/Hydraulic Load: 7.5kw
  • Total Connection: Ensure your local substation or internal board can handle a dedicated 100kw draw.
  • Isolator Placement: A lockable rotary isolator should be installed within 2 meters of the machine's final position for safety and maintenance.

3.  Clearances & Workspace

To ensure safe operation and maintenance access, observe the following "Clear Zone" requirements:

  • Front/Rear Access: Minimum 1500mm clearance for loading/unloading and platen maintenance.
  • Side Access: Minimum 1000mm for hydraulic pump and oil heater service panels.
  • Vertical Clearance: The machine stands at 2550mm.  Ensure at least 500mm of overhead clearance for ventilation and hydraulic hose movement.

4.  Logistics & Delivery Access

Moving 18.5 tonnes requires specialised equipment.

  • Access Route: Ensure all bay doors and internal gangways can accommodate a 1.8m width and have a floor rating capable of supporting the machine and the transport skates/forklift.
  • Offloading: A heavy-duty crane or specialised machinery moving skates will be required.

Environmental & Safety

  • Ventilation: While the oil system is closed-loop, the 120 Celsius operating temperature and adhesive curing process required a well-ventilated area or local exhaust ventilation (LEV).
  • Commissioning: Initial heating cycles must be monitored by a qualified engineer to ensure air is purged from the oil lines.

4.  UK Tax Advantages (Capital Allowances)

The HOP 25/1300 qualifies as Plant and Machinery.  In many cases, UK businesses can take advantage of Annual Investment Allowances (AIA), allowing you to deduct the full value of the investment from your taxable profits in the year of purchase.

Note: We recommend consulting with your accountant to confirm the specific tax benefits available to your business.
